Question 1

This question is about waves in the electromagnetic spectrum.

a.

The diagram below shows the regions of the electromagnetic spectrum ordered from longest wavelength to shortest wavelength, with two regions labeled P and Q currently missing.

radio wavesmicrowavesPvisible lightultravioletQgamma rays \begin{array}{|c|c|c|c|c|c|c|} \hline \text{radio waves} & \text{microwaves} & \text{P} & \text{visible light} & \text{ultraviolet} & \text{Q} & \text{gamma rays} \\ \hline \end{array} radio waves​microwaves​P​visible light​ultraviolet​Q​gamma rays​​

Identify the missing regions P and Q.

[2]
b.

Which electromagnetic radiation is used in thermal imaging cameras and short-range remote control devices?

  • A ultraviolet
  • B infrared
  • C microwaves
  • D X-rays
[1]
c.

Which electromagnetic radiation is used for sterilising surgical instruments and in radiotherapy to destroy cancer cells?

  • A infrared
  • B microwaves
  • C ultraviolet
  • D gamma rays
[1]
d.

The list of electromagnetic waves ordered from radio waves to gamma rays is in order of:

  • A decreasing frequency
  • B increasing speed in a vacuum
  • C decreasing wavelength
  • D increasing wavelength
[1]
e.

Excessive exposure to certain types of electromagnetic radiation can be hazardous to human health.

For two different types of electromagnetic radiation, describe:

  • a harmful effect on the human body,
  • how the risk of exposure can be reduced.
[4]
